For Adrienne Madhavpeddi, the path to a doctorate in global health was paved not just with textbooks and lectures, but with direct, on-the-ground experience in the healthcare field. Rather than confining her studies to the academic environment, Madhavpeddi actively sought out opportunities to work with multiple organizations, gaining a pragmatic understanding of how health systems operate in real-world settings.
Originally from Red Deer, Alberta, Canada, Madhavpeddi is set to graduate this May from Arizona State University’s School of Human Evolution and Social Change with a PhD in global health. Her journey through graduate school was defined by a commitment to bridging the gap between theoretical knowledge and practical application. By immersing herself in various healthcare environments, she developed a nuanced perspective on the challenges and complexities facing global health initiatives.
This hands-on approach allowed Madhavpeddi to see firsthand the disparities and logistical hurdles that often go unmentioned in academic discussions. Her experience underscores a growing recognition that effective solutions in global health require more than just scholarly insight; they demand a deep, empathetic understanding of the communities and systems being served. As she prepares to receive her degree, Madhavpeddi’s unique blend of academic rigor and real-world exposure positions her to make a meaningful impact in the field.
